Johana Origin and Meaning
The name Johana is a girl's name of Czech origin.
Johana is a feminine name that serves as a variation of Johanna, which is the feminine form of John. With Hebrew origins, it carries the beautiful meaning "God is gracious." This spelling variant removes one 'n' from the traditional Johanna, giving it a slightly more streamlined appearance while maintaining its classical essence. Johana is particularly popular in Czech Republic, Slovakia, and Spanish-speaking countries. While less common than Johanna in English-speaking regions, its international appeal and biblical connections make it an elegant, timeless choice. The name offers the cute nickname options of Jo, Jojo, or Hana, adding to its versatility.
